London: Gay and Hancock, Ltd., 1911. Original Cloth. VG-. 1911, second edition revised, ccxl, 595pp, cloth with 2 maps and 25 plans. Cover and spine faded; First map torn; rear hinge starting; well used but still VG- overall. Extremely well written series.
